About Medical Malpractice Law in Bahrain

Medical malpractice refers to instances where a healthcare provider's actions or omissions result in harm or injury to a patient. In Bahrain, medical malpractice cases are governed by specific laws to ensure that patients receive fair compensation for any harm caused by healthcare providers.

Local Laws Overview

In Bahrain, medical malpractice cases are usually handled by the Bahrain Medical Liability Law, which outlines the responsibilities of healthcare providers, patient rights, and procedures for seeking compensation for medical malpractice. It is important to consult with a lawyer familiar with these laws to ensure your rights are protected.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What constitutes medical malpractice in Bahrain?

In Bahrain, medical malpractice involves a healthcare provider's negligence or failure to provide the standard of care expected in their field, resulting in harm or injury to a patient.

2. How do I prove medical malpractice in Bahrain?

To prove medical malpractice in Bahrain, you will need to show that the healthcare provider breached their duty of care, causing harm or injury to you as a patient. This often requires expert testimony and detailed evidence.

3. What are the time limits for filing a medical malpractice claim in Bahrain?

In Bahrain, the time limit for filing a medical malpractice claim is usually within three years from the date of the incident or from the date you discovered the harm caused by medical malpractice.

4. Can I sue a healthcare provider for medical malpractice in Bahrain?

Yes, you can sue a healthcare provider for medical malpractice in Bahrain if you can prove that their negligence or breach of duty caused harm or injury to you as a patient.

5. What damages can I claim for in a medical malpractice case in Bahrain?

In a medical malpractice case in Bahrain, you may be able to claim damages for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other related costs resulting from the medical malpractice incident.

6. Can I file a complaint against a healthcare provider for medical malpractice in Bahrain?

Yes, you can file a complaint against a healthcare provider for medical malpractice in Bahrain with the Bahrain Chamber for Dispute Resolution or the Ministry of Health, who will investigate the matter and take appropriate action.

7. Do I need a lawyer for a medical malpractice case in Bahrain?

While it is not mandatory to have a lawyer for a medical malpractice case in Bahrain, having legal representation can greatly improve your chances of success and ensure that your rights are protected throughout the legal process.

8. Are there any caps on damages for medical malpractice cases in Bahrain?

In Bahrain, there are no specific caps on damages for medical malpractice cases, but the amount of compensation awarded will depend on the specific circumstances of the case and the extent of harm or injury caused by the medical malpractice.

9. Can I settle a medical malpractice case out of court in Bahrain?

Yes, you can settle a medical malpractice case out of court in Bahrain through negotiations with the healthcare provider's insurance company or through mediation or arbitration. However, it is advisable to seek legal advice before agreeing to any settlement.
